PORT ANGELES — The North Olympic Library System will continue online book discussion groups throughout September.
Participants must register at www.nols.org to receive the link to the free Zoom meetings.
The Second Tuesday Book Discussion Group will meet at 11 a.m. Tuesday to discuss “Sapiens : a Brief History of Humankind” by Yuval Noah Harari.
Paperback copies are available for curbside pickup at the Port Angeles Branch Library.
In October the group will discuss “America: The Farewell Tour” by Chris Hedges.
The Second Saturday Book Discussion Group will meet at 3 p.m. Saturday, Sept. 12, to discuss “The Home Place: Memoirs of a Colored Man’s Love Affair with Nature” By J. Drew Lanham.
Paperback copies are available for curbside pickup at the Sequim Branch Library.
The group will discuss “Homo Deus: A Brief History of Tomorrow” By Yuval Noah Harari in October.
The Novel Conversations Book Discussion Group is set to meet at 4 p.m. Wednesday, Sept. 23, to talk about “The Overstory” by Richard Powers.
Paperback copies are available for curbside pickup at the Sequim Branch Library.
The group plans to discuss “The Book Woman of Troublesome Creek” by Kim Michele Richardson in October.
The Wednesday Evening Book Discussion Group will meet at 6:30 p.m. Wednesday, Sept. 23, to discuss “The Skeptics’ Guide to the Universe: How to Know What’s Really Real in a World Increasingly Full of Fake” by Steven Novella.
Paperback copies are available for curbside pickup at the Port Angeles Branch Library.
Their October selection is “Circling the Sun” by Paula McLain.
